On 4/27/21 3:42 AM, Pavel Balaev wrote:
> After running "scripts/checkpatch.pl" I got warnings about alignment.
> So I run checkpatch.pl --fix and fixed alignment as a script did.
> So warnings goes away. I don't get the rules of alignment, can you 
> tell me the right way?

I don't see any statements under Documentation/process; not sure where
it is explicitly stated. You can get the general idea by following the
surrounding code and then let checkpatch correct from there.
